An underground loader, commonly known as an LHD (Load-Haul-Dump) machine or "mucker," is a heavy-duty, low-profile earthmoving vehicle engineered specifically to scoop, transport, and discharge loose ore and blasted rock within the tight constraints of subterranean mines and tunnels.
Tactile and Surface Textures:
Chassis Exterior: Coated in thick, high-durability epoxy paint over carbon steel, creating a rough, matte, heavily textured armor surface designed to resist corrosion from acidic mine water and abrasive wall scrapes.
Ground Engaging Tools (GET): The bucket lip features a coarse, granular, ultra-hard texture from specialized mechanically attached chromium-carbide wear plates or weld-on shrouds engineered to pierce jagged, blasted rock facades.
Heavy-Duty Tires: LHD tires feature a smooth, slick, or deep-tread rock pattern with a highly dense, cut-resistant compound texture. They use reinforced sidewalls to prevent puncture damage from razor-sharp quartz or granite fragments.
Functions
Three-in-One Functionality (Load-Haul-Dump)
LHDs eliminate the need for distinct loading shovels and haul trucks in smaller mines. They single-handedly dig material at the blasting face, transport it rapidly down the drift, and dump it directly into gravity chutes, underground crushing hoppers, or specialized mine trucks.
